Unleashing The Flavors Of Tuscany: Lucca Olive Oil Tasting
Lucca, a picturesque town set in the heart of Tuscany, Italy, is not just known for its stunning historical architecture and captivating landscapes. It is also celebrated for its world-renowned olive oil, which has been produced in the region for centuries. lucca olive oil tasting experiences offer a unique opportunity to explore the nuances of this liquid gold that has been an essential ingredient in Italian cuisine for generations.
The olive groves surrounding Lucca are known for producing some of the finest extra virgin olive oils in the world. The mild climate and fertile soil of the region create ideal conditions for olive trees to thrive, resulting in olives that are rich in flavor and aroma. Lucca olive oil is characterized by its delicate fruity notes, balanced bitterness, and peppery finish, making it a favorite among chefs and food enthusiasts alike.
One of the best ways to appreciate the complexities of Lucca olive oil is through a tasting experience. Olive oil tastings are similar to wine tastings, where participants sample different varieties of olive oil to discern their unique characteristics. During a lucca olive oil tasting, participants are guided through a tasting of various oils, learning about the production process, flavor profiles, and pairing suggestions.
The first step in a lucca olive oil tasting is to examine the appearance of the oil. Extra virgin olive oil should be clear and bright, with a golden-green hue. The color can vary depending on the type of olives used and the ripeness at which they were harvested. Participants are encouraged to observe the viscosity of the oil as well, as high-quality olive oil will have a smooth and silky texture.
Next, participants are instructed to smell the oil to detect its aroma. Lucca olive oil is prized for its fresh and fruity scent, with notes of green grass, artichoke, and almond. The aroma can vary depending on the olive variety and the processing methods used. By taking a moment to savor the aroma, participants can begin to anticipate the flavors they will encounter during the tasting.
After smelling the oil, participants move on to the tasting portion of the experience. The oil is typically served in small cups or on pieces of bread to help enhance the flavors. Participants are encouraged to take a small sip of the oil and let it coat their palate before swallowing. This allows them to fully experience the nuances of the oil, from its initial sweetness to its peppery finish.
During the tasting, participants are guided through the different flavor profiles of the oils, learning to discern characteristics such as fruitiness, bitterness, and spiciness. Olive oils from Lucca are known for their well-balanced flavors, with a harmonious blend of sweet and savory notes. Participants are encouraged to pay attention to the mouthfeel of the oil as well, noting its smooth texture and lingering finish.
In addition to sampling the oils on their own, participants also have the opportunity to taste them with various foods. Lucca olive oil pairs beautifully with fresh bread, salads, grilled vegetables, and even desserts. By experimenting with different pairings, participants can discover how the flavors of the oil complement and enhance a wide range of dishes.
